Buyer’s Guide to Weight Lifting Straps

Why should you use lifting straps?

The most common and compelling answer to this question is that it allows you to lift more! One of the most frustrating feelings in the gym is when you have to limit your weight for deadlifts or similar exercises because of your failing grip. Straps have the ability to dramatically increase your grip by effectively tying your arm to the barbell.

A few other benefits are that they will lessen callouses on your hands and provide a bit of extra wrist support. Although they are fairly simple pieces of equipment, there are a few important considerations you should take into account before making a purchase.

What you should look for in a lifting strap

Type of Strap

There are three common types of straps: single-loop, lasso and figure-8. Lasso straps are by far the most common, and they are the straps we focussed on for this product review. They provide the best balance between a secure grip on the barbell and versatility.

Grip

Weightlifting straps are almost always made from heavy-duty cotton. While these provide good grip (which is slightly dependant on the type of weave), there are normally some enhancements included. Most straps boost their grip with the use of rubberised typography and dots along the inside of the straps. These also improve durability.

Padding

Some weightlifters prefer padding while others don’t. Padding on the wrist can stop the wrist wrap part of the strap from digging into the top of the wrist. The material most often used for this is Neoprene foam, which is durable, cushioning and breathable. However, for some, this padding can actually be more uncomfortable.
